About
This evergreen shrub is cherished for its lush, glossy green foliage, providing a vibrant understorey accent. It produces clusters of small, often white or cream flowers that develop into striking, colourful berries, typically red or orange, adding seasonal interest.
Where it works in Kilifi
Thriving in dappled shade to full shade, this shrub is ideal for creating a lush understorey in Kilifi gardens, especially beneath larger trees. It adapts well to various well-drained soils and can be used for informal hedging, accent planting, or ecological restoration.
Growing notes
It exhibits a moderate growth rate and, once established, requires moderate watering, particularly during extended dry spells. This hardy species is well-suited to the coastal climate, needing minimal care to flourish.
